Geez, I just took a look and thought it was a 44 Orchard and here its a 101
now thats rare.  Only a little over 4700 Senior standards made.  I do 
believe
you are correct that SS is Senior Standard.  Normally, the Serial number 
would
look something like:

101GS-362103

There could be a 1 or 5 after the G for either regular altitude or High 
Altitude.

First 101 Orchard I ever saw.
